Real‑World Performance & In‑Depth Feature Analysis
Build Quality & Material Performance
The housing feels like a reinforced silicone‑polymer blend; it stays supple at 500 °F and never softens enough to sag. The copper core is thick enough to handle the extra amperage without noticeable voltage drop, which we confirmed with a 0.02 Ω resistance reading across a 10‑foot segment. The double‑spring lock terminals click firmly, and after 500 km of rough road they showed no sign of loosening.

Daily Operation & Performance
On a stock 5.0 L V8, the set delivered an average 8 % increase in torque across the 3,500‑6,500 rpm band, peaking at 12 % at 6,200 rpm. Fuel consumption stayed flat, indicating the gain is truly from better spark energy, not richer tuning. Under full‑throttle runs on a dyno, cylinder pressure rose from 1,850 psi to 2,070 psi – a clear sign of the advertised fire‑power boost.
Setup Experience & Compatibility
Unboxing revealed a neatly packaged 8‑piece set, each wire pre‑tinned and labeled. Installation on a 2019 Mustang GT took 11 minutes per side for a seasoned DIYer; the only hiccup was the 90° boot angle rubbing against the intake manifold on the driver’s side, solved by gently rotating the boot 5° outward. The supplied 4‑mm wrench fit the lock terminals perfectly.
Long‑Term Durability & Reliability
We ran a 72‑hour heat‑soak at 650 °F in a controlled oven (to simulate extreme conditions) and the insulation showed zero cracking or discoloration. After 5,000 km of mixed driving, there were no misfires attributable to the wires, and the resistance remained within factory tolerance.

Frequently Asked Questions
- Can I use this set on a supercharged V8? Yes, the heat rating of 600 °F covers the higher combustion temps typical of forced induction.
- Do I need to replace the coil when swapping these wires? No, the set is compatible with most aftermarket coils as long as the connector type matches.
- What is the warranty period? Taylor Cable offers a 12‑month limited warranty against material defects.
- Will the 90° boot affect my intake manifold? On tightly‑packed engines it may require a 5° rotation; most V8s have enough clearance.
- How does the resistor core increase fire power? The built‑in resistor stabilizes spark energy, reducing voltage drop and allowing a hotter, more consistent spark.
- Is the set ARP‑approved for racing? It meets most amateur racing series’ electrical standards, but always check your specific sanctioning body.
- Can I install the wires without removing the coil packs? No, the design requires coil removal to access the plug boots.
- Do these wires affect fuel economy? In our tests fuel consumption remained unchanged; the gain is purely performance‑focused.
